Output dfb80ca0959950f1f304e86ed907a3383a1da645baeacda8f2899974480532ed:3

value
156889499841
script pubkey
OP_0 OP_PUSHBYTES_20 59d2ac9560cb47ce14940cf82401790a85999939
address
ltc1qt8f2e9tqedruu9y5pnuzgqtep2zenxfe7kyt9g
transaction
dfb80ca0959950f1f304e86ed907a3383a1da645baeacda8f2899974480532ed
spent
true